Output 6151b416597dc14aaeb5a2f9e3017b21e4e0c02b79a2db36c7bf51b65e4d571f:2

value
29864900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 af8fef41b2de3d68bf10fbf82e5b32cb0831c0d9 OP_EQUALVERIFY OP_CHECKSIG
address
DM9PDaapFQDoMugJNp4zGs3BS3b11dMAus
transaction
6151b416597dc14aaeb5a2f9e3017b21e4e0c02b79a2db36c7bf51b65e4d571f